Is Rincon, GA a Good Place to Live?
Rincon receives an overall livability grade of B+ (72/100), indicating solid livability relative to the rest of Georgia. Safety scores B+ (72/100). Affordability scores B+ (76/100) with a median household income of $76,960 and median home values around $228,900.
About 27.9%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the unemployment rate is 4.1%. 72% of housing is owner-occupied. The median age is 35.
